UP Assembly(Vidhansabha) Monsoon Session 2018 starts tomorrow

Uttar Pradesh Legislative Assembly President Harsimrat Narayan Dikshit has requested all the leaders of the parties to provide support to the smooth running of the monsoon session beginning on August 23. In this all-party meeting convened by the Speaker,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ath said that we are committed to constructing the discussion, discussing maximum discussion and for more time. He said that our government is ready to discuss all subjects. We are also looking forward to resolving the issues raised in the House and the problems of the people. He appealed to run the House smoothly.

President Dikshit requested all party leaders that they should keep their opinion in the House with decency and parliamentary dignity and maintain the quality of the debate. He said that no system can be ideal, there is always room for improvement in its quality. He said that there is a favor in all the democratic countries of the world, there is consensus, consensus, consensus, disagreements, there is logic, per logic. and for these matters, debate happens.

A leader of the Opposition Ram Govind Chaudhary, Bahujan Samaj Party leader Lalji Verma, Congress leader Ajay Kumar alias Lallu also expressed their views and assured them in every way to support the proceedings of the House systematically. A leader of Opposition said that democracy is shrinking in the present time. There is not enough discussion happened on various subjects in the assembly. We demanded to increase the session days and discuss more issue in single day.

BSP’s Lal G Verma assured the cooperation in the House and expressing concern over the violation of the House’s limits. Suheldev Samaj Party leader Om Prakash Rajbhar also attended the meeting. At the end of the meeting, all the party leaders expressed their deep sympathy towards their families on the demise of former Prime Minister Atal Bihari Vajpayee and kept a two-minute silence for the peace of the departed soul.
